Berry Farms Rd Sturbridge, MA 01566
This exceptional 1-acre commercial parcel in Sturbridge, MA, presents a unique investment opportunity. Located on a new 1000-foot commercial cul-de-sac, the property boasts town water and sewer access. Zoning allows for a variety of uses, including retail, office, or residential development. While the 1-acre lot is currently offered, up to 4.4 acres are available for acquisition. Furthermore, an adjacent 54-acre parcel is also available, suitable for a wide range of projects, including a 55+ community, assisted living facility, nursing home, hospital, 40B development, single-family attached homes, or multi-family rental units, subject to town approvals. This larger parcel has the potential for over 180 units. The seller is actively planning a 7,500 square foot building, which can be purchased outright, leased, or leased with an option to buy. The seller is also open to constructing a building to suit the buyer's needs, with the capacity to build up to 50,000 square feet. The property enjoys exceptional access to major roadways, including Route 49, Route 20, Route 148, Route 131, I-84, and I-90, providing unparalleled connectivity throughout Central New England. Its proximity to UMASS Harrington Hospital (1 mile) and I-90 and I-84 (3.2 miles) further enhances its desirability.
